Decoding the copyright: Separating Myth from Reality

For centuries, the Brotherhood has captured the fancy of society with its shrouded history and alleged influence on world events. Often portrayed as a powerful, conspiratorial organization controlling global power, the copyright has become a staple in conspiracy theories. However, separating fact from fiction requires a closer examination of its origins and evolution.

Contrary to popular belief, the historical copyright was a real organization founded in Bavaria in 1776 by Adam Weishaupt. Its initial purpose was to promote Enlightenment and oppose superstition and religious influence over public life. But, its existence was short-lived, disbanded by Bavarian authorities just a few years later. Despite its limited lifespan, the idea of a powerful, secret society persisted in popular culture.

Nowadays, the concept of the copyright has taken on a new life in conspiracy theories that often link it to everything from popular media to extraterrestrial encounters. While these claims are largely unsubstantiated, they demonstrate the enduring appeal with the idea of hidden power structures operating behind the scenes.
